/zh/
zh
true
2653
29304
5593
5
Detroit
61
44085
detroit
Detroit
52
42.329256
114
-83.046305
12
false
113
1,5,6
83
0
2389
32544
$
1807077
在地图上
Street ViewExplore
地址Russell St, 6599